Q. Explain Restricted fragment polymorphism?
This method makes use of a group of enzymes termed restriction enzymes which recognise particular sequence of DNA and act as "molecular scissors" to cut at the beginning and end of these sequences. When DNA from one individual is cut this way, and the resulting fragments are subjected to electrophoresis, the fragments become aligned by length enabling the recognition of a pattern. The analysis of patterns from different individuals permits an assessment of variation in their DNA sequences. Measuring the differing frequencies of the various patterns in a population or species can indicate the genetic diversity within the group.
